The MC54HC164AJ is an 8-bit serial-in/parallel-out shift register, manufactured by Rochester Electronics. This device is designed to convert serial data into parallel data. The HC164 family provides high-speed operation and low power consumption, making it suitable for various digital applications.

Features:
- High Speed: tPD = 14 ns (typ) at VCC = 5V
- Low Power Dissipation: ICC = 4 μA (max) at TA = 25°C
- High Noise Immunity: VNIH = VNIL = 28 % VCC
- Output Drive Capability: 10 LSTTL Loads
- Symmetrical Output Impedance: |IOH| = IOL = 4 mA (min)
- Balanced Propagation Delays: tPLH ≈ tPHL
- Wide Operating Voltage Range: VCC = 2V to 6V
- Serial data input
- Asynchronous reset

Additional Details:
The MC54HC164AJ operates over a wide temperature range, typically -55°C to +125°C, making it suitable for industrial and military applications. It is supplied in a ceramic Dual In-Line Package (DIP), providing robust mechanical and environmental protection. The device features a clear (reset) input that allows for easy initialization of the register.
